Can I view existing spatial layers from other sources with MicroStation GeoGraphics?
MicroStation GeoGraphics will automatically see any existing spatial layers that reside in the current schema regardless of whether these layers are registered as part of a MicroStation GeoGraphics spatial project or not. Non registered layers will be available for query purposes only. Additionally, since element attribute information may be in a format unrecognized by MicroStation GeoGraphics, these layers will initially query back in pure Oracle Spatial format: point, line and polygons without style. In order to query these layers back with the desired element attributes, they will either need to be feature coded and incorporated into the project or this information can be provided via XML.
